NVIDIA Corp. (NVDA)
Update 6/15/2017: NVDA traded sideways during the period I held the position, and I exited at my target price of 25% of maximum potential profit.
Shares declined by -1.0% over six days, or a -60% annual rate. The options position produced a 33.3% yield on debit for a +2,025% annual rate.
NVDA has sufficiently high implied volatility on all the metrics I use — against the annual range, current trend and VIX — that it is worth examining for a trade.
I shall use options that trade for the last time 14 days hence, on June 23.
Implied volatility stands at 42%, which is 4.1 times the VIX, a measure of the volatility of the S&P 500 index.
NVDA’s IV stands in the 52nd percentile of its annual range and the 75th percentile of its most recent broad movement.
The price used for analysis was $149.96.

The premium is 45% of the width of the position’s wings.
The risk/reward ratio is 1.2:1.
Decision for My Account
I have entered an order on NVDA as described above. The stock at the time of entry was priced at $149.32.
